Comprehending ADHD Private Titration
Private titration describes the customized modification of medication does based upon the specific needs and actions of a client with ADHD. Unlike basic treatment procedures that may adopt a one-size-fits-all technique, private titration ensures that the medication routine is individualized for maximum efficacy and very little negative effects.
The Process of Private Titration
The titration process includes several stages to identify the optimum medication dose. Below are the essential steps typically involved:

Initial Assessment: An extensive evaluation by a healthcare specialist is conducted to validate the ADHD medical diagnosis and comprehend the client's health history.

Medication Selection: Based on the evaluation, an ideal medication is selected. Common choices include stimulants (e.g., methylphenidate, amphetamines) and non-stimulants (e.g., atomoxetine).

Starting Dose: The doctor will recommend a preliminary low dose of the selected medication, allowing the body to adjust and minimize the risk of negative reactions.

Keeping an eye on Response: Regular follow-up consultations are arranged to keep an eye on the patient's progress. This might involve surveys, discussions about sign changes, and assessments of adverse effects.

Dose Adjustment: Based on the patient's action and any negative effects experienced, the doctor may adjust the dose. This can take place in several models up until the optimal dose is discovered.

Upkeep: Once the ideal dosage is determined, continuous tracking is vital to guarantee continued effectiveness and make any required adjustments due to modifications in the client's condition or scenarios.

The benefits of private titration are manifold, boosting the overall treatment experience for people with ADHD:

Personalization: Each patient's requirements are unique. Private titration permits a personalized approach that considers individual actions to medication.

Enhanced Efficacy: By closely monitoring and changing does, health care service providers can enhance the effectiveness of treatment, causing better sign control.

Minimized Side Effects: A steady titration process helps to determine any unfavorable responses early, enabling the company to make modifications before unfavorable results end up being serious.

Holistic Support: This approach frequently accompanies holistic assistance that consists of therapy, behavior modifications, and way of life adjustments.
Factors To Consider for Private Titration
While private titration uses substantial advantages, there are likewise some considerations to bear in mind:

Cost: Private titration might not be covered by insurance, resulting in higher out-of-pocket expenditures.

Accessibility of Specialists: Access to health care companies who focus on ADHD and private titration can be limited in some regions.

Time Commitment: The titration process needs regular check outs for monitoring and changes, which can be challenging for some clients.

Patient Education: Patients need to comprehend the process to take part actively in their treatment, which requires also being notified about potential negative effects and the significance of adherence to the procedure.
